Wrapped Newborn Photo
A simple wrapped photo keeps the focus on baby. Use a soft blanket, neutral background, and gentle natural light for a clean announcement image.

A small name card can make the announcement feel complete. Keep the card simple so the image feels soft and easy to read.

Tiny hands, feet, hospital bracelet, or a soft blanket detail can make a beautiful announcement photo when paired with a short message.

A quiet photo holding baby can feel deeply personal. It does not need to show everything. The connection is enough.

Baby’s going home outfit can become part of the announcement. Photograph it on baby or as a soft flatlay before the first trip home.
